macOS VSCode配置c/c++环境
2021-11-05 13:00 作者:Shellblock | 我要投稿

注:本教程适用于M1系列芯片
环境
macOS Monterey 12.0.1
VSCode 1.62.0 M1版
🔗 https://code.visualstudio.com/sha/download?build=stable&os=darwin-arm64
终端配置
打开Mac终端执行:
注意:此步骤必须执行,否则会出现检测到 #include 错误,请更新 includepath报错,以前配置过的可以忽略直接进行下一步。
安装插件
C\C++
C\C++ Clang Command Adapter
CodeLLDB(用来debug,解决Catalina不支持lldb调试问题)
code runner(用来编译)
添加配置文件
c_cpp_properties.json
tasks.json
launch.json
如果VSCode已经创建好的话直接修改文件内容即可。
配置c_cpp_properties.json文件
配置tasks.json文件
配置launch.json文件
注意
如果更改了程序的内容,保存之后,需要重新shift+command+B,产生新的exec(Unix可执行文件)文件,然后再按F5调试才是修改后的结果,否则仍然是修改前的运行结果。